The Polycom VVX 411 is a business media phone designed for unified communications, featuring a high-resolution color display, support for up to 12 lines, HD Voice quality, Power over Ethernet (PoE), USB connectivity, and integration with leading UC platforms. Below are key sections for safety, features, installation, setup, operation, and troubleshooting.
Key components: Color touchscreen display, Handset, Base unit, Ethernet ports, USB port, Headset jack.
| Feature | Description |
|---|---|
| Display | High-resolution color touchscreen for call management and applications |
| Lines | Supports up to 12 lines with individual line keys |
| Audio | HD Voice with wideband audio for superior call clarity |
| Connectivity | Dual Ethernet ports (LAN and PC), USB port for accessories |
| Power | Power over Ethernet (PoE) or optional external power adapter |
| Headset Jack | 3.5mm jack for wired headset connectivity |
| Speakerphone | Full-duplex speakerphone for hands-free conversations |
| UC Integration | Compatible with Microsoft Teams, Zoom, RingCentral, and others |
| Firmware | Upgradable firmware for feature enhancements |
| Mounting | Optional wall mount kit available |

Access menus via the touchscreen or dedicated hard keys. Front Panel: Mute, Headset, Speakerphone, Navigation keys, Line/Feature keys.
Touchscreen Interface: Home screen with call lines, applications, and status. Swipe for more options.
Settings Menu: Navigate to Settings icon. Options include: - Sounds: Ringtone selection, volume levels for ringer, speaker, handset. - Display: Brightness, screen timeout, wallpaper. - Network: View IP address, network status, configure VLAN. - Advanced: Admin settings, firmware update, factory reset (requires admin password).
Network: Ethernet cable to LAN port. PC: Ethernet cable from PC port to computer. Headset: 3.5mm plug to headset jack. USB: For compatible accessories like Bluetooth adapters.

Visual Alerts: Flashing LED for incoming calls. Audio Adjustments: Independent volume control for ringer, handset, speaker. TTY Support: Configurable for Teletypewriter compatibility. Large Font: Option to increase text size on display.
Unplug power before cleaning. Use a soft, dry cloth to wipe the display and casing. For stubborn marks, lightly dampen cloth with water only.
CAUTION! Do not use abrasive cleaners, solvents, or aerosols. Avoid getting moisture into openings.

| Symptom | Possible Cause | Corrective Action |
|---|---|---|
| No power/display blank | Power source | Check Ethernet/PoE connection; try external power adapter; ensure cable is secure. |
| No dial tone | Network/configuration | Verify Ethernet cable is connected to LAN port; check network configuration; restart phone. |
| Poor audio quality | Network/device | Check network bandwidth; ensure handset cord is fully plugged in; try a different headset. |
| Phone not registering | Provisioning | Verify server settings and account credentials; contact system administrator. |
| Touchscreen not responsive | Calibration/software | Restart the phone; check for firmware updates; perform factory reset if needed. |
Reset: Settings > Advanced > Factory Reset (requires admin password).
